Femke Kok dominates 500m speed skating to end Jackson’s hopes of retaining Olympic title

Speed skater Femke Kok had admitted that anything but gold in her signature 500m race would be a disappointment after opening her Olympic account last Monday with silver in a Dutch one-two alongside Jutta Leerdam in the 1000m. On Sunday evening, she performed like an athlete insistent on leaving no room for doubt.

Femke Kok dominates 500m speed skating to end Jackson’s hopes of retaining Olympic title

TL;DR

  • Femke Kok won Olympic gold in the 500m speed skating with an Olympic record of 36.49 seconds.
  • Jutta Leerdam took silver, and Miko Tahagi won bronze.
  • Erin Jackson, the defending champion, finished in fifth place.
  • Kok's victory was her first Olympic gold and adds to her three world titles.
  • Kok has not lost a 500m race since February 2, 2024, and broke the world record in November.
